Press launch of Abandon Normal Devices –

 

Launching in Liverpool 23-27 September 2009, AND features screenings, installations, online projects, public realm interventions, debates, workshops and live events, with a distinctive emphasis on critique and ideas. At the heart of this festival lies a fascination with ideas about social, physical and technological norms with approaches from the playful to the downright provocative.

Featured highlights include: First UK solo exhibition from Thai filmmaker Apichatpong Weerasethakul; European premiere exhibition from digital interrogators The Yes Men; world premiere of Jamie King’s new feature film Dark Fibre (STEAL THIS FILM), a much anticipated appearance from Carolee Schneemann and Krzysztof Wodiczko’s return to the UK with a breath-taking outdoor projection. Also an outdoor performance on the waterfront by DJ Spooky and much more.

VIEWING: Trip Through My Window

imageTHURSDAY 9 July 2009, 18.00 – 20.00 at Arena Gallery
New works by Anna Ketskemety. Often using personal photography and her early background in architecture as a reference point, Ketskemety’s work explores the relationships between the flat surface and her constructs by employing painting as an exploratory method that calls into question the distinction between the painting and the object. VIEWING: FIS 09

imageTHURSDAY 9 July 09, 18.00 – 20.00 at Novas CUC
The title FIS meaning “Vision” allows an open approach to the personal vision of the artist. The chosen artists all adopt a sensitive approach to their work. The majority of the aritsts are living in rural communities which creates an atmosphere of quiet contemplation. While three of the artists Una Sealy and David Quinn and Emma Berkery live in urban environments they each approach their subject matter from an outside perspective. Exhibition details
